Cluttercore: Gen Z's revolt against millennial minimalism is grounded in Victorian excess

By Vanessa Brown, Course Leader MA Culture, Style and Fashion, Nottingham Trent University
Have you heard maximalism is in and minimalism is out? Rooms bursting at the seams with clashing florals, colourful furniture and innumerable knick-knacks, this is what defines the new interiors trend cluttercore (or bricabracomania).

Some say it’s a war between generation Z (born 1997-2012) and minimal millennials (born 1981-1996), symptomatic of bigger differences. Others say it’s a pandemic response, where our domestic prisons became cuddly…The Conversation
